Abstract
The invention discloses a nutritional powder made of pholiota adipose and a preparation process thereof. The nutritional powder takes fresh pholiota adipose as the raw material and is prepared by the processes of blanching, cooling, solarizing, baking, grinding and the like. The nutritional powder is rich in protein, carbohydrates, vitamins and various mineral elements, and can be widely used in the food industry.

Background technology
Yellow umbrella, Latin formal name used at school Pnoliota adiposa (Fr.) Quel, having another name called fertile squama umbrella, greasiness squama umbrella, Jin Liugu, Huang Liugu, willow mushroom etc., is a kind of fungi of very famous and precious medicine-food two-purpose, mainly grows in the zone, the Huanghe delta, on the willow withered tree in two sides, the Yellow River and forest zone in blocks.Nutritive value to yellow destroying angel protein is studied, the result shows, yellow destroying angel protein contains 17 seed amino acids, essential amino acid accounts for 40% of total amino acid content, its amino acid ratio coefficient divides up to 66.53, and is higher by 42.74% than straw mushroom (Volvariella volvacea), tea firewood mushroom (Agrocybe aegerita) and shaggy cap (Coprinus comatus) respectively, 50.89% and 36.58%.The yellow umbrella protein of these presentation of results has higher nutritive value.

Summary of the invention
The object of the present invention is to provide a kind of pholiota adipose nutritional powder and preparation technology thereof, this nutrient powder is a raw material with new cadmium yellow umbrella, makes through blanching, cooling, Exposure to Sunlight, baking, pulverizing.
The object of the present invention is achieved like this:
A kind of pholiota adipose nutritional powder, it is characterized in that it is made by following preparation technology: with new cadmium yellow umbrella is raw material, makes through blanching, cooling, Exposure to Sunlight, baking, pulverizing.
A kind of preparation technology of pholiota adipose nutritional powder is characterized in that it comprises the steps: that with new cadmium yellow umbrella be raw material, makes through blanching, cooling, Exposure to Sunlight, baking, pulverizing.
Described blanching step is: yellow umbrella is gathered the back with boiling water processing 5~10 minutes, must cool off rapidly after the blanching.
Described blanching, cooling step should be finished in 5~6 hours.
Described Exposure to Sunlight step is: shone under the sun 4~5 hours.
Described baking procedure is: roasting plant is to indulge to blow the type air-heater, since 35 ℃, per hour increases by 2 ℃ during baking, and temperature improves gradually, and maximum temperature is 70 ℃ during baking, and the standard of yellow umbrella drying is that moisture is controlled at below 10.0%.
Described pulverising step is: yellow umbrella is pulverized the back and is crossed 100 mesh sieves.
Described pholiota adipose nutritional powder is characterized in that in the preparation Application in Food.
The technological process of pholiota adipose nutritional powder is as follows:
Blanching → cooling → Exposure to Sunlight → baking → pulverizing
The pholiota adipose nutritional powder nutritional labeling is comparatively complete, removes to contain rich nutrient substances, outside protein, fat, cellulose and multivitamin and inorganic salts, also contains multiple bioactivators such as amino acid, polysaccharide, ergosterol.Amino acid A wide selection of colours and designs in the pholiota adipose nutritional powder (18 kinds), total content is compared higher with other food (medicine) with bacterium; The ratio of glutamic acid, aspartic acid, isoleucine, lysine, valine and alanine content is higher in the total amino acid.The TEAA of protein is 6.32, the nonessential amino acid total amount is 10.37, total amino acid content is 16.69, essential amino acid accounts for 37.87% of total amino acid content (E/E+N), essential amino acid and nonessential amino acid ratio (E/N) are 0.61, and the ideal protein essential amino acid (E%) that has reached FAo/WHO (1973) proposition should reach total amount about 40%, the N value should be in the requirement more than 0.6.The mineral element that contains multiple needed by human such as potassium, sodium, calcium, phosphorus, magnesium, iron, zinc, manganese in the pholiota adipose nutritional powder, wherein the trace elements iron, zinc, the manganese content that lack easily of human body is higher, is about 2 times of general edible mushroom.
Pholiota adipose nutritional powder can be widely used in being used for cooked wheaten food in the food service industry, as cake, bread, cake etc.; The raw material filling that is used for pastries is as mooncake filling, Lantern Festival filling etc.; Be used for instant food, after frying, can directly dash food with hot water or milk; Can also make soup stock.
Specific embodiment
The specific embodiment of form is described in further detail foregoing of the present invention by the following examples, but this should be interpreted as that the scope of above-mentioned theme of the present invention only limits to following embodiment.All technology that realizes based on foregoing of the present invention all belong to scope of the present invention.
Embodiment 1
Get the yellow umbrella 360kg of fresh, free from admixture, no insect population; Yellow umbrella is put in the boiling water into blanching 6-8 minute; Take out yellow umbrella, be placed on and drain away the water above slipping through the net, be cooled to room temperature with the fan blowing simultaneously; Move to outdoorly slipping through the net, yellow umbrella shone 4.5 hours in sun lights; Yellow umbrella is sent into baking box, and set the baking program: per hour increase by 2 ℃, temperature improves gradually, and maximum temperature is 70 ℃ during baking, starts air-heater, stoving time 3 hours, moisture 8.5%; Yellow umbrella is pulverized, crossed 100 mesh sieves, pack gets pholiota adipose nutritional powder.
Embodiment 2
Get the yellow umbrella 360kg of fresh, free from admixture, no insect population; Yellow umbrella is put in the boiling water into blanching 6-8 minute; Take out yellow umbrella, be placed on and drain away the water above slipping through the net, be cooled to room temperature with the fan blowing simultaneously; Move to outdoorly slipping through the net, yellow umbrella shone 5 hours in sun lights; Yellow umbrella is sent into baking box, and set the baking program: per hour increase by 2 ℃, temperature improves gradually, and maximum temperature is 70 ℃ during baking, starts air-heater, stoving time 3.5 hours, moisture 8.0%; Yellow umbrella is pulverized, crossed 100 mesh sieves, pack gets pholiota adipose nutritional powder.
